Obsidian logo

Obsidian

Obsidian is completely free for personal use with all core features included. You get unlimited notes, full plugin access, and complete control over your data at no cost.

For users who want to sync notes across devices, Obsidian Sync offers two plans. The Standard plan costs $4 per month when paid yearly (or $5 monthly) and includes one synced vault with 1GB storage. The Plus plan costs $8 per month yearly (or $10 monthly) with 10GB storage and unlimited vaults.

Obsidian Publish lets you share notes on the web for $8 per month yearly (or $10 monthly) per site, with custom themes and no technical knowledge needed.

The optional Commercial License costs $50 per user yearly for business use, though it became optional in 2025. For one-time supporters, the Catalyst license at $25 gives early access to beta versions and community perks.

Reor logo

Reor

Reor is completely free to use with no paid plans or subscriptions. As an open-source project licensed under AGPL-3.0, you can download and use all features without any cost.

The app runs AI models locally on your computer, which means you do not need to pay for cloud services. You can use free models from Ollama or connect to your own OpenAI account if you prefer.

There are no hidden fees, premium tiers, or feature limitations. Everything is available to all users from the start. The project is maintained by volunteers and accepts contributions from the community. You can even modify the source code to fit your specific needs since it is open source.
